A market study of colour printers

The printer manufacturing market seems to be a booming one. Manufacturers are little question eyeing enlargement and coming back up with newer product to capture the burgeoning market. The makers are curious about the colour -printer sector for purely reasons of expansion. There is stiff competition between the makers as all are concentrating to keep the costs low to capture the market. It must be said here that whereas in the monochrome department Hewlett-Packard co. are the market leaders, the reigning company in the colour section still remains undecided.

But the longer term of the color printer market is alleged to be a bright one in step with those investing in these companies. The investors are much optimistic, as these printers, using four times the toner cyan, magenta, yellow, and black of a monochrome printer, will manufacture pictures of a much higher quality. The market, currently a billion dollar trade, will increase manifold.

Adding on to its product vary, printing large Lexmark introduced its c52x series, which included the c524n last June. Earlier there was a huge gap in its colour line up-there was merely the low- end c510 with a capacity of printing about eight colour and 30 monochrome photos in a very single minute that wasn’t all that fast. There conjointly existed, facet-by-aspect, the high-end c762 that, though having a higher speed, was a lot of additional expensive, thereby troublesome to afford for the smaller offices and residential users. As there was no alternative product catering to the strain of the users the competitors of Lexmark had a grip over it.

The introduction of Lexmark’s c524n however changed things.
They introduced this product with a very low worth vary, thereby creating it affordable. Giving a dpi resolution of 1200*1200, this network prepared colour laser printer has an impressive colour output and can print up to twenty pages per minute. The terribly 1st page might be printed in as little as 13seconds. The model includes a monthly most duty cycle of 65000 pages, which is sort of impressive. The new c524 additionally reduces the time taken by print jobs considerably as it has a 437.5MHz processor and 128Mbytes of memory. The memory will be expanded up to 576, which decreases the waiting time taken for print jobs. Moreover, color care technology and Lexmark coverage estimator facilitate in managing the value concerned in using color toner. The model, weighing 57 pounds, is 17.three inches wide, 19 inches high and 20.a pair of deep.  With the model also comes a CD consisting of the user guide and also the printer software, a power cable, a paper exit extension tray, set up sheet and toner cartridges for cyan, yellow, magenta and black. The product includes a one-year warranty amount for on site repair.

It goes without saying that that outsourcing of IT and consumer electronic product lower manufacturing prices of the product, which helps lower the prices of the created good. The query is how low should the producers keep their profit margins in order to remain within the race in these days’s colour printing market?

The present analysis lab examined the c524n at a product volume of 1,twenty,000 units under the idea {that the} model was created in china. An analysis was created of the procurement prices of commodity parts, producing costs of fabricated components and placement labour rates. The production cost was estimated to be around £265 / unit. The price distribution showed the price of the printer mechanism and its assembly to be concerning £51. The electronics and assembly account for £60. Alternative prices included laser power provide, consumables assembly, fuser assembly, paper assembly, control panel assembly electronics assembly, final arrangements, etc.

At the time of launching the product, the merchandise was alleged to be priced at £390. But, Lexmark priced the merchandise at virtually 0.5 of the originally intended price at some places. To maximize its revenue, the corporate during a clever move, outfitted the toner with totally different toner cartridges. The toner content was increased or decreased per the budget of the customer. The more expensive models containing additional toner catered to the strain of the enterprise phase whereas the lower priced models with low yield cartridges were ideal for little offices and also home users.

The product, being suitably priced, was a nice success, perfectly fitted to meet the requirements of the buyers and therefore the manufacturers and compete with its competitors in the lucrative colour printer market. Lexmark claimed the print quality was Photorealistic. On account of its chemically processed, spherical toner delivering a 1200*1200 dpi resolution and additionally as a result of the new print head four lasers in one unit with a mirror. The machine enabled Lexmark to require on the enterprise market plus their competitors, especially Hewlett-Packard.

10 Questions Your Company Should Answer When it Comes to Data Recovery

Filed under: Data recovery — Tags: , , , , , — Author @ 7:46 am

One of the most overlooked facets of the company information technology structure is an appropriate backup and disaster recovery system. With all of the technology available today, the absence of even the most elementary backup system is a mortal sin in regard to the business technology universe. There are affordable backup and data recovery systems in every price range, so even companies with limited budgets can afford an elementary system at the very least. Also many computer services firms now offer backup and data recovery systems as integral parts of their managed IT services.

Here are the top 10 questions to answer when pondering the right backup and data recovery system:

1. What do I do if I delete a file I need?
2. Where is my email stored and is it backed up?
3. What if my computer crashes? Even if my data is saved how long will it take me to rebuild my computer to a functioning state?
4. Is my data all located in the same physical space?
5. Will a catastrophe wipe out my backup solution i.e. {an earthquake,a fire, a flood}?
6. Does my business rely on any one system for important functions? How long can my business operate without a functioning system? Does my current backup solution accomodate that expectation?
7. Does anyone I work with know how to recover information if I need to use my backups that are in place?
8. Are my backups tested so I know they work?
9. Are my backups monitored so I know if they are ever failing?
10. Is the backup data media (i.e. hard drives or tapes) transferred in a secure, controlled manor since it contains all data for my entire business?

These questions covers about 1/4 of the questions that one should review when it comes to a practical backup and disaster recovery solution so if you haven’t asked yourself these questions, start today!  If you are overwhelmed, contact a local computer services provider which should be able to assist your company.

About Data Forensics

Filed under: Computer Forensics — Tags: , , , , , , — Author @ 4:43 pm

Forensics is an ever evolving science with a lot of possibilities get deeper knowledge about by different forensics training or forensics classes.
The number of crimes involving electronic data is sky-rocketing these days, particularly with the immense preponderance of computers and other digital media in our lives. Thus, data forensics has become a distinct sub-division of forensic science consisting of technical expertise, the finding of electronic evidence, digital investigations and even data recovery. Data forensics is right to use in judicial cases that involve sexual harassment, intellectual property theft, discrimination, breach of contract and so on. Therefore, it was not difficult for data forensics to become a legal necessity in the context of the computers’ ubiquity.

A normal type of computer investigation cannot detect or extract bits of information remained after deletion. File left-overs, deleted files, hidden and discarded files are searched and analyzed as part of the data forensics analysis. Although there are lots of challenges when trying to identify the criminal process or to recover data, this search for the needle in the haystack is pretty successful. What relevance does such evidence have for legal cases? Well, practice has already proved it that even the course of a trial could be changed by the retrieval of deleted e-mail messages for instance.

The challenges that data forensics expert have to face are enormous. The applications are indeed far-reaching, but it takes hours to extract digital evidence and make it stable. Sometimes the extractor has difficulties in getting to the information that is buried too deep in the electronic system, or too exposed to destruction. Moreover, for a successful data collection, data forensics has to protect the extracted elements by duplication so that  the information is preserved and not altered and spoiled during the process. Lots of skills, strict standards and great caution are needed for each of these steps and only real pros can succeed.

When a criminal act involving digital systems is detected, the best way of action is not to address the other party and ask for a preservation of computer records, but rather a surgical approach by an expert in data forensics. This will enable the appropriate and cost-limited data collection in the best conditions possible. Moreover, it is false to assume that data forensics only applies to computer hard drives as the main systems that can store information; there are cases of criminal action involving, USB devices, CDs, DVDs and even voice mail systems. Even photocopy machines include hard drives and the scanned or copied documents can be afterwards retrieved from them.

5 Steps to Recovering Your Data

Filed under: Data recovery — Tags: , , , , , — Author @ 9:38 am

There's no getting round the fallibility of computers: the motherboard might die, the power supply may become beyond repair or the whole thing might just become ridden with viruses and slow to a crawl.  If you decide to buy a replacement computer then the issue of data backup from the old machine to the new one is very important.  Use the following steps if you find yourself in this situation:

1) Once you have unplugged the cables and peripherals from your old computer you will then be ready to remove the hard drive from the broken computer.The computer's handbook should show you the right way to open the case.Many older machines will have a case that requires unscrewing in order to gain access, whereas others will have latches that simply have to be 'pushed' open.

2)  Now you have the components exposed you should be especially wary of causing damage via static electricity, as anyone well versed in ict facts will tell you.In order to de-static yourself touch something metal before you go near your computer.  Repeat this every time you step away from your machine.

3)  Next you should locate the hard drive.This should be simple enough as it should be located at the front of the computer in a slot near the CD drive.Again, in old computers it may be attached by screws.

4) Disconnect the hard drive PSU and data cable by gently pulling them out.Unscrew the hard drive if you need to and then remove it. 

5)  You should then insert the hard drive into the external hard drive enclosure.Plug the (USB) data cable into an available port on the new working machine.Your new computer should then automatically recognise this as an external drive and assign it a letter as appropriate.You should then be able to gain access to the data on your old hard drive.

If you are looking for for more sophisticated data backup solutions then you may want to approach a specialist provider.

How to Choose the right Backup Storage Device - 12 Top Tips

It used to be the case that you would backup everything on your computer using floppy disks.Today, when one sound or graphics file can easily be larger than the capacity of a disk, it would be impractical to back up even you documents with floppies, let alone your applications.  Luckily there are better options including Zip disks, CD writers, tape drives, external hard drives and even online backup services.You can also compress all of your backed up files so that they will take up less space.Follow the below tips and you will be able to find the media that is best suited to your needs.

1) Next, determine the approximate quantity and file sizes you will be backing up.

2) Figure out the quantity and file sizes of any documents or other applications you want to archive permanantly to a backup device or removable media.

3) Plan for that amount to grow in the future.

4) You should work out your budget for a backup storage device and removable media to use with it.

5) Consider if you plan to archive photographs or scanned files, need portability of the media or the drive itself, wish to record music for playback on some other equipment, or need ease of use.Weigh these factors against your need to back up your files.

6) Calculate the total cost per MB of media for each drive that you are considering.zip drives themselves are cheap but the disks aren't.

7) You may want to consider buying a 100MB zip drive if you need limited storage capability (less than 1GB).An external parallel port or even USB Zip drive will provide versatility and portability.  Buy a 250MB Zip drive if your storage needs are moderate (a few GB). 

8) Buy an internal zip drive if you will only use the drive for backup and you are able to install it by yourself (installation fees will add up).

9) Buy a CD-RW drive if you decide that your storage needs are more moderate and you will regularly back up more than 500MB of data.

10) Buy a Jaz drive or even a tape backup drive if you will be backing up large amounts of data regularly.

11) Buy an external hard disk if you will require a lot of space, wont be keeping old backups and dont need portability.

12)  If you require additional security, data protection and the ability to recover your data quickly then online data backup should be a serious consideration.
